SSO: I can totally help you setting up a new one but Imma save you a $10 processing fee by using these steps:
- Open the app and tap BILL.
- Tap Set up a Payment Arrangement. This will only appear if there is a balance due.
- Tap Continue and view the Amount.
The amount due will default to the minimum payment necessary to be eligible for a payment arrangement. To change the payment dates, tap the date you wish to change. 4.Tap Payment Method. Previously stored payment method will show, if available.
- Follow on screen prompt.
